The conjugation of the verb ESTAR is as follows:
Yo Estoy
Tu Estás
El Está
Nosotros Estamos
Vosotros Estáis
Ellos Están
Why?
In Spanish, each pronoun has a different conjugation. There are also different conjugations depending on the verb tense. The previous ones were in present tense.
The verb ESTAR is like the verb TO BE in English, but related to a place or to an activity that the person is doing.
An example of a sentence using the verb ESTAR is:
Yo estoy Comiendo (I am eating)
Tu estás en Casa (You are at home)
El está feliz (He is happy)
